LOW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2016 in Review

1,215 of the 3,748 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Lowe's Companies (LOW) for Q2 2016, worth a combined $53.8B — up 5.5% from $51B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 107 funds opened new LOW positions and 52 closed out — a net gain of 55 holders — while 412 added to existing stakes and 505 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Macquarie Group, adding an estimated $716M. The largest seller was Royal London Asset Management, cutting an estimated $1.31B.
